  • Abstract
    Multidimensional arrays used in MOLAP are often sparse. They also suffer from the problem that the time consumed in sequential access to array elements heavily depends on the dimension along which the elements are accessed. This problem would be alleviated by dividing the whole array into the set of the same sized smaller subarrays called "chunks". These chunks are also sparse and they are compressed. However these compressed chunks are usually arranged in the predetermined order of the dimensions. This would produce further dimension dependency in accessing array elements. In this paper, by introducing the notion of a "chunk container", we resolve the problem of this further dimension dependency.
